Mastering structured streaming and spark streaming by gerard maas. Pdf stream processing with apache flink download full pdf. Deep analysis with apache flink andreas kunft tu berlin dima andreas. Click download or read online button to get mastering hadoop 3 book now.
True streaming built on top of apache kafka, state is first class citizen. Apache flink, and apache kafka streams toggle navigation. Learning apache flink pdf learning apache flinkmastering apache flink,tanmay deshpande,2017. Learning apache flink mastering apache flink,tanmay deshpande,2017. Apache flink is a scalable and faulttolerant processing framework for streams of data. Apr 28, 2015 this page is a collection of material describing the architecture and internal functionality of apache flink. Build your experitse in processing realtime data with apache flink and its ecosystem. The apache flink community is excited to hit the double digits and announce the release of flink 1.
Mar 24, 2016 this face to face talk about apache flink in sao paulo, brazil is the first event of its kind in latin america. Learn how to build end to end real time analytics projects. Discover the definitive guide to crafting lightningfast data processing for distributed systems with apache flink about this book build your expertize in processing realtime data with apache flink and its ecosystem gain insights into the working of all components of apache flink such as flinkml, gelly, and table api filled with real world use cases exploit apache flink s capabilities like. Neha narkhede, gwen shapira, and todd palino kafka. Mastering hadoop 3 download ebook pdf, epub, tuebl, mobi. Mastering aws development is suitable for beginners as it starts with basic level and looks into creating highly effective and scalable infrastructures using ec2. Apache flink1 is an opensource system for processing streaming and batch data. Integrate with existing big data stack and utilize existing. Exploit apache flinks capabilities like distributed data streaming, inmemory processing, pipelining and iteration operators to improve performance. Fundamentals of apache flink video free pdf download.
Mastering aws development is suitable for beginners as it starts with basic level and looks into creating highly effective and scalable infrastructures using ec2, ebs, and elastic load balancers, and many aws tools. Architecture,stream, batch stream,table api,gelly,flinkml and so on. This is the code repository for mastering apache flink, published by packt. Earlier in my blog, i have discussed about how its different than apache spark and also given a introductory talk about its batch api. Definitive guide to lightning fast data processing for distributed systems with apache flink this is code repository for the snippets provided in the book mastering flink. Understanding the differences between spark vs flink slideshare uses cookies to improve functionality and performance, and to.
Learning apache flinkmastering apache flink,tanmay deshpande,2017. Gain expertise in processing and storing data by using advanced techniques with apache spark about this book explore the integration of apache spark with third party applications such as h20, databricks and titan evaluate how cassandra and hbase can be used for storage an advanced guide with a combination of instructions and practical examples to extend. Attachments 0 page history resolved comments page information view in hierarchy view source delete comments export to pdf export to epub export to word pages apache flink home. Please have a look at the release notes for flink 1. Fundamentals, implementation, and operation of streaming applications. Apache hadoop is one of the most popular big data solutions for distributed storage and for processing large chunks of data. Mastering structured streaming and spark streaming gerard maas, francois garillot before you can build analytics tools to gain quick insights, you first need to know how to process data in real time.
With this practical guide, developers familiar with apache spark will learn how to put this inmemory framework to use for streaming data. Get started with apache flink, the open source framework that powers some of the worlds largest stream processing applications. Mastering windows presentation foundation pdf libribook. Apache flink is an open source stream processor that helps you quickly react to the most recent changes in your business environment. Discover the definitive guide to crafting lightningfast data processing for distributed systems with apache flink about this book build your expertize in processing realtime data with apache flink and its. Discover the definitive guide to crafting lightningfast data processing for distributed systems with apache flink about this book build your expertize in processing realtime data with apache flink and its ecosystem gain insights into the working of all. Have you heard of apache flink, but dont know how to use it to get on top of big data. Stream processing with apache spark by maas, gerard ebook.
Mastering structured streaming and spark streaming francois garillot, gerard maasisbn10. Use apache flink and its ecosystem to process realtime big data. Pdf learning apache cassandra download ebook for free. In the following, we show how flinks predefined window assigners work and how they are used in a. Flinks pipelined runtime system enables the execution of bulkbatch and stream processing programs. Tuning is done automatically in apache flink in apache spark you need to optimize the parameters yourself 24. The core of apache flink is a distributed streaming dataflow engine written in java and scala. Flink internals apache flink apache software foundation. Discover the definitive guide to crafting lightningfast data processing for distributed systems with apache flink about this book build your expertize in processing realtime data with apache flink and its selection from learning apache flink book.
Dec 22, 2015 im pretty much in the same position, but after having been learnt apache spark for over 100 consecutive days im better prepared for the exercise. How it maintains consistency and provides flexibility. The engine runs in a microbatch execution mode by default 37 but it can also use. Exploit apache flink s capabilities like distributed data streaming, inmemory processing, pipelining and iteration operators to improve performance. Packt publishing,ankit jain, 341 understand the core concepts of apache storm and realtime processing follow the steps to deploy multiple nodes of storm cluster create trident topologi. This book will be your definitive guide to batch and stream data processing with apache flink. I finally know what worked well be focused on one task at a time. In batch world, flink looks very similar to spark api as it uses similar concepts from mapreduce. You can use the provided color scheme which incorporates some colors of the flink logo. The engine runs in a microbatch execution mode by default 37 but it. It contains all the supporting project files necessary to work through the book from start to finish. Apache flink is not only a platform for data processing, it is also a platform for scalable, and fast exploratory data analytics.
Before you can build analytics tools to gain quick insight. This book will help you in learning batch and stream data processing with apache flink to. This site is like a library, use search box in the widget to get ebook that you want. You can read online learning apache cassandra here in pdf, epub, mobi or docx formats.
Apache hadoop mapreduce, and the two apache spark and apache flink platforms, which have recently been featured with great prominence. Stream processing with apache flink free pdf download. Pdf mastering apache spark download read online free. Discover the definitive guide to crafting lightningfast data processing for distributed systems with apache flink. Mastering structured streaming and spark streaming. In this book, ellen friedman and kostas tzoumas introduce apache flink. Want to make it through the next interview you will appear for. Best practices for scaling and optimizing apache spark holden karau. If you want to run flink on windows you need to download, unpack and configure the flink archive as mentioned above. This page is a collection of material describing the architecture and internal functionality of apache flink. This aws book is written by uchit vyas which is an indian writer. Apache flink is an opensource streamprocessing framework developed by the apache software foundation. Click download or read online button to get stream processing with apache flink book now.
The definitive guide realtime data and stream processing at scale beijing boston farnham sebastopol tokyo. The apache flink community released the third bugfix version of the apache flink 1. Stream processing with apache flink download ebook pdf. In code, flink uses timewindow when working with timebased windows which has methods for querying the start and endtimestamp and also an additional method maxtimestamp that returns the largest allowed timestamp for a given windows. Fundamentals, implementation, and operation of streaming applications fabian hueske, vasiliki kalavriisbn10.
Stream processing with apache spark free pdf download. Download learning apache cassandra ebook free in pdf and epub format. Realtime stream processing with apache flink digitale. Gain insights into the working of all components of apache flink such as flinkml, gelly, and table apifilled with real world use cases. Hone your skills with our series of hadoop ecosystem interview questions widely asked in the industry. In order to read online or download hadoop real world solutions cookbook second edition ebooks in pdf, epub, tuebl and mobi format, you need to create a free account. Stream processing with apache spark mastering structured streaming and spark streaming. To build analytics tools that provide faster insights, knowing how to process data in real time is a must, and moving from batch processing to stream processing is absolutely required. Flink executes arbitrary dataflow programs in a dataparallel and pipelined manner. Gain insights into the working of all components of apache flink such as flinkml, gelly, and table api filled with real world use cases. Streaming benchmark 14, as in trill 12, and also lets structured streaming automatically leverage new sql functionality added to spark. Memory management improvements with apache flink 1. If you plan to use apache flink together with apache hadoop run flink on yarn, connect to hdfs, connect to hbase, or use some hadoopbased file system connector, please check out the hadoop integration documentation. Introduction to stream processing with apache flink tu berlin.
With basic to advanced questions, this is a great way to expand your repertoire and boost your confidence. Mar 07, 2016 apache flink is one of the new generation distributed systems which unifies batch and streaming processing. As a result of the biggest community effort to date, with over 1. Apache flink is an open source platform for scalable batch and stream. Functionality of apache spark is a subset of the functionality of apache flink apache flink not yet capable of mixing data streams and data batches but planned for a future version. After that you can either use the windows batch file. A simple introduction to apache flink archsaber medium. Apache flink provides capabilities to analyze large quantities of streaming data, and. This readme gives an overview of how to build and contribute to the documentation of apache flink. Download pdf learning apache cassandra free usakochan pdf. It is intended as a reference both for advanced users, who want to understand in more detail how their program is executed, and for developers and contributors that want to contribute to the flink code base, or develop applications on top of flink. Stream processing with apache spark pdf free download. Have you used flink, but want to learn how to set it up and use it properly.
The documentation is included with the source of apache flink in order to ensure that you always have docs corresponding to your checked out version. Learn all about the ecosystem and get started with hadoop today. Stream processing with apache flink pdf free download. Download mastering apache cassandra pdf ebook mastering apache cassandra mastering apache cassandra ebook author by jas. A comprehensive guide to mastering the most advanced hadoop 3 concepts. The latest entrant to big data processing, apache flink, is designed to process continuous streams of data at a lightning fast pace. Before you can build analytics tools to gain quick insights, you first need to know how to process data in real time. It contains all the supporting project files necessary to work through the book from start. Gain expertise in processing and storing data by using advanced techniques with apache spark about this book explore the integration of apache spark with third party applications such as h20, databricks and titan evaluate how cassandra and hbase can be used for storage an advanced guide with a combination of instructions and practical examples to. We cannot guarantee that hadoop real world solutions cookbook second edition book is in the library, but if you are still not sure with the service, you can choose free trial service.
299 999 361 1364 1544 1223 603 738 487 1353 726 781 262 1280 1122 1264 771 508 1382 699 973 755 1302 143 591 3 228 1024 416 1262 727 571 1001 530 1031 1382 537 171 191 485 734 1207 475 698 1004 815 172 351 309